What skills and experience we're looking for
An exciting opportunity has arisen for a Social, Emotional and Mental Health Manager (SEMH) at Frome College to lead, coordinate, deliver and evaluate a range of interventions which support SEMH students, including Looked After students, ensuring student engagement, access to learning and improved outcomes is facilitated for all SEMH students. The post holder will have day to day operational management of Child Protection cases and line mange the Pastoral Team.
Candidates will need to demonstrate the following
- good line management, administration, organisational and problem-solving skills
- excellent interpersonal and communication skills and the ability to provide advice and guidance to staff in SEMH
- good literacy and numeracy skills, with the ability to implement and evaluate systems as well as analyse data
- IT literate and a sound working knowledge of Microsoft packages
- ability to engage positively and successfully with all young people, working flexibly both in 1:1 & group settings

Commitment to safeguarding
Our organisation is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children, young people and vulnerable adults. We expect all staff, volunteers and trustees to share this commitment.
Our recruitment process follows the keeping children safe in education guidance.
Offers of employment may be subject to the following checks (where relevant):
childcare disqualification
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S)
medical
online and social media
prohibition from teaching
right to work
satisfactory references
suitability to work with children
You must tell us about any unspent conviction, cautions, reprimands or warnings under the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974 (Exceptions) Order 1975.
